RUF-restored Porsche 901 Wins Best in Class and Art Center Awards at 2023 Pebble Beach Concours d'Elegance

Alois Ruf's personal 1963 Porsche 901 prototype, the oldest example left in existence that was once owned by Ferdinand Piëch, won two coveted awards at this year's Pebble Beach Concours

Alois Ruf Jr., head of RUF Automobile, took home the Art Center College of Design Award and Best in Class in the Porsche 75th Anniversary category with his 1963 Porsche 901 'Quickblau' prototype at this year's Pebble Beach Concours d'Elegance. The wins come on the tail of Ruf's recent successes with the car at Concorso Eleganza Villa d'Este, where it won the Best in Class and Best Iconic Car awards. Chassis number six, once owned by both Ferdinand Piëch and Hans Mezger, is the oldest known 911 in existence.

Ruf Jr. fell in love with the 911 because of this very car. While driving on the Autobahn in 1963 with his father, he heard and saw a bright blue Porsche overtake them and was instantly smitten. The family was already fascinated by the Porsche marque with Alois Ruf Sr. owning a mechanic shop, AUTO RUF, that saw many 356 models pass through it. For his 19th birthday, Ruf Sr. gifted his son a 911 that the previous owner had wrecked. Ruf Jr. kept the car in his garage for decades while focusing on building RUF Automobile into the revered brand it is today. As the 911 aged and turned into a classic, Ruf Jr. decided to begin the restoration in 2019.

Upon further research, he discovered this was one of the first 911s ever built (then called the 901), which was thought to have been lost forever. It served as Ferdinand Piëch's company car in 1963 before selling to Hans Mezger. After driving it for two years, Mezger sold it to an entrepreneur who wrecked it on a racetrack. Ruf Sr. purchased the project car for his son, and the rest is history.

'It is the car that opened the hearts of so many people,' said Alois Ruf Jr. 'The 911 is a part of our lives. For the gray-haired people or the young people, it is the most successful sports car ever built.'
